NSFAS is the National Student Financial Aid Scheme, the South African government's funding body that is tasked with making university and TVET College studies available to students from families that can't usually afford the fees.

Their 'student centered model' allows individual students to keep a check on their own bursary applications and accounts. They can login to their MyNSFAS accounts on the NSFAS website.

What Your NSFAS Status Check Updates Mean

One of the most common NSFAS official status messages you will see on your own MyNsfas account is the NSFAS 'evaluation' status, when tracking your NSFAS application to the NSFAS website. This means that NSFAS is verifying every one of the supporting demanded documents you've got submitted all through your NSFAS login and application.
